14 Faculty Positions (Regular/Guest Faculty): RGNIYD

Rajiv Gandhi National Institute of Youth Development (RGNIYD) is an Institute of National Importance by an Act of Parliament functioning under the Department of Youth Affairs, Ministry of Youth Affairs and Sports, Government of India.

Total Number of Positions: 14

Designation

Professor (Academic Level 14)

Associate Professor (Academic Level 13A)

Assistant Professor (Academic Level 10)

Department

  1. Applied Psychology
  2. Mathematics
  3. English
  4. Computer Science (Data Science)
  5. Computer Science (Artificial Intelligence & Machine Learning)
  6. Computer Science (Cyber Security)
  7. S.W. (Youth and Community Development)
  8. Development Studies

Eligibility requirements

  1. The candidate must be a citizen of India.
  2. Interested candidates should apply only online.
  3. MSc., and Ph.D.,
  4. First Class in all the degree programs with good SCI/SCIE Publications

Application Procedure

  1. Applicants are advised to send the downloaded online application with all supporting documents to the Institute.
  2. All the documents in support of Research and Academic contribution must be enclosed with the application.
